mysqldump
命令来导出MySQL数据库到一个文件。,,``bash,,mysqldump -u 用户名 -p 数据库名 > 导出的文件.sql,,
``,,请将"用户名"、"数据库名"和"导出的文件.sql"替换为实际的用户名、数据库名和文件路径。在执行此命令时,系统会提示你输入密码。MySQL数据库导出一个文件的方法有很多,这里介绍一种常用的方法:使用mysqldump
命令。
步骤1:打开命令行窗口
在Windows系统中,按下Win+R键,输入cmd
并回车;在macOS或Linux系统中,打开终端应用程序。
步骤2:执行mysqldump命令
在命令行中输入以下命令:
mysqldump -u 用户名 -p 数据库名 > 导出文件路径
将用户名
替换为你的MySQL用户名,数据库名
替换为你要导出的数据库名称,导出文件路径
替换为你希望保存导出文件的路径和文件名。
如果你的用户名是root
,要导出名为mydatabase
的数据库,并将文件保存到D:\backup\mydatabase.sql
,则命令如下:
mysqldump -u root -p mydatabase > D:\backup\mydatabase.sql
步骤3:输入密码
执行上述命令后,系统会提示你输入密码,输入正确的密码后,命令将继续执行。
步骤4:等待导出完成
导出过程可能需要一些时间,具体取决于数据库的大小和服务器的性能,完成后,你会看到命令行显示导出成功的消息。
注意事项:
确保你有权限访问指定的数据库。
导出的文件将以SQL格式保存,可以在需要时导入到其他MySQL服务器上。
如果导出过程中出现错误,请检查命令是否正确输入,以及是否有足够的磁盘空间。
相关问题与解答:
1、问题:如何查看当前MySQL服务器上的所有数据库?
解答:可以使用以下命令来查看所有数据库:
```
mysql -u 用户名 -p -e "SHOW DATABASES;"
```
输入密码后,你将看到一个包含所有数据库名称的列表。
2、问题:如何将导出的SQL文件导入到另一个MySQL服务器?
解答:可以使用以下命令将导出的SQL文件导入到另一个MySQL服务器:
```
mysql -u 用户名 -p 新数据库名 < 导入文件路径
```
将用户名
替换为目标MySQL服务器的用户名,新数据库名
替换为你想要导入数据的数据库名称,导入文件路径
替换为你要导入的SQL文件的路径。
到此,以上就是小编对于“mysql导出数据库一个文件_文件导出”的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。